I also noticed some references on the list about the KXV3 RX ANT isolation problem. I assume you know this is covered on the K3 Enhancements and Application Notes page under "Receive Antenna TX Isolation Improvement (RXA Mod Kit for the KXV3)". This mod is not required for units with the KXV3 "Rev B" Main Board. http://www.elecraft.com/K3/k3_app_notes.htm 73, Bill W4ZV -- View this message in context: http://n2.nabble.com/It-have-to-work-better%21-tp1572093p1572212.html Sent from the [K3] mailing list archive at Nabble.com. _______________________________________________ Elecraft mailing list Post to: [email protected] You must be a subscriber to post to the list.
